What Happens During a Lightning Protection Consultation?
At ATS, our lightning protection consultations start with a thorough site assessment and risk evaluation. We review your current system design, coverage, grounding, bonding, air terminals, down conductors, and surge protection system. We then identify the compliance requirements to keep your facility safe and up to code.
Our full lightning protection consulting process typically involves:
- Inspection of Existing Systems
- Design Review
- Standards and Compliance Review
- System Evaluation
- Testing & Verification
- Engineering Analysis & Recommendations
- Recertification and Reporting/Documentation
Our consultants also provide detailed documentation, including photos and repair recommendations.
What Codes and Standards Apply to Lightning Protection Systems?
We verify that your lightning protection systems comply with recognized industry and safety standards for design, installation, inspection, insurance requirements, and maintenance. The most common standards and codes reviewed during a lightning protection system consultation include:
- NFPA 780
- UL 96A
- IEC 62305 series (where international standards apply)
